SVB Wealth LLC lessened its holdings in shares of TE Connectivity Ltd. (NYSE:TEL - Free Report) by 22.8%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 19,041 shares of the electronics maker's stock after selling 5,614 shares during the period. SVB Wealth LLC's holdings in TE Connectivity were worth $2,691,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

TE Connectivity Trading Up 2.3%
TEL opened at $204.8070 on Friday. TE Connectivity Ltd. has a one year low of $116.30 and a one year high of $212.76. The stock has a market capitalization of $60.52 billion, a PE ratio of 42.40, a P/E/G ratio of 2.38 and a beta of 1.23. The business's 50 day moving average price is $186.36 and its 200 day moving average price is $161.57.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.39, a quick ratio of 0.96 and a current ratio of 1.52.
TE Connectivity (NYSE:TEL -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 23rd. The electronics maker reported $2.27 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$2.08 by $0.19. TE Connectivity had a return on equity of 20.22% and a net margin of 8.78%.The firm had revenue of $4.53 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$4.30 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$1.91 earnings per share.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 13.9% on a year-over-year basis. TE Connectivity has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 2.270-2.270 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ts expect that TE Connectivity Ltd. will post 8.05 EPS for the current year.
TE Connectivity Announces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 12th. Shareholders of record on Friday, August 22nd will be paid a dividend of $0.71 per share. This represents a $2.84 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.4%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, August 22nd. TE Connectivity's dividend payout ratio is 58.80%.

TE Connectivity Profile
(
Free Report)
TE Connectivity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ells connectivity and sensor solutions in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the AsiaPacific, and the Americas. The company operates through three segments: Transportation Solutions, Industrial Solutions, and Communications Solutions.
